ESEM.L vs. HEMC.L
ESEM.L (Invesco MSCI Emerging Markets Universal Screened UCITS ETF Acc) and HEMC.L (HSBC MSCI Emerging Markets UCITS ETF USD (Acc)) are both Emerging Markets Equities funds - ESEM.L tracks the MSCI EM (Emerging Markets) Universal Select Business Screens Index while HEMC.L tracks the MSCI EM NR USD. Both are passively managed. Over the past 3 years, ESEM.L returned 23.60%/yr vs 23.65%/yr for HEMC.L. Their correlation of 0.93 suggests significant overlap in exposure. ESEM.L charges 0.19%/yr vs 0.15%/yr for HEMC.L.
